 * Hi!
 * When I try to install this on a test server, I get at Http error 500.
    As soon
   as I delete the folder from the plugins folder, my site come back up again.
 * I’m using WordPress 4.5.3 with a custom theme.
    Listing version 0.3.0 is installed
   an activated.

 * Can you please [enable debug mode](https://codex.wordpress.org/Debugging_in_WordPress#WP_DEBUG)
   on your site and activate the Listings Jobs plugin again? This might show us 
   the actual error that is being suppressed under that 500 HTTP error.
 * Can you also please verify that you’re running the latest stable version of Listings
   Jobs (currently v0.2.1)?

 * So far so good.
    And the I activate the plugin. Then I just get this: `Parse 
   error: syntax error, unexpected T_CLASS, expecting T_STRING or T_VARIABLE or '
   $' in /DATA/apache/html/stage/wp-content/plugins/listings-jobs/src/Plugin.php
   on line 64`

 * Thanks for reporting this issue.
 * It looks like we’ve got some code that needs to be refactored for PHP 5.3 compatibility.
 * As we want to keep a minimum requirement of 5.3 we’ll working on a quick fix 
   right now and will update you once we’ve got something committed to .org for 
   you to download and get on your way.
